Senior Manager, Software Engineering

Visa Logo

Visa

πŸ’΅ $116k-$211k
πŸ“Remote - United States

Summary

Join Visa, a global leader in payments technology, as a Senior Software Engineering Manager. You will be a key member of a multi-functional team developing and maintaining Open Banking products for the US market. This role involves leading a high-performing engineering team, working with various technologies (Java, PHP, NodeJS, AWS, etc.), and ensuring high-quality product delivery. You will collaborate with product management, mentor engineers, and drive innovation within a fast-paced environment. The position is remote, offering flexibility, and comes with a competitive salary and comprehensive benefits package.

Requirements

8 or more years of relevant work experience with a Bachelor Degree or at least 5 years of experience with an Advanced Degree (e.g. Masters, MBA, JD, MD) or 2 years of work experience with a PhD

Responsibilities

  • Work with high load systems with high uptime requirements, including on-call shifts
  • Work with Tink’s technologies which is mainly Java, PHP, NodeJS, AWS, Kubernetes, Docker, SQL, Datadog and much more
  • Be responsible for the overall delivery and quality delivered by your team. You will enable the team to reach their targets by removing impediments, clarifying goals and fostering ownership and accountability
  • Own the team’s overall planning, execution, and success of complex technical projects cross-product teams
  • Work closely with product management to ensure we're building products in the best way and to deliver on customer commitments and targets
  • Setting clear priorities and providing leadership in a fast-paced and innovative environment
  • Work on discovery, investigating and trying out new solutions with the team
  • Mentor and motivate a high performing team of senior technology engineers to achieve critical business goals and KPIs
  • Ability to thrive in a fast-paced, dynamic environment and manage multiple priorities
  • Ability to write elegant, robust code to rapidly produce proofs-of-concept or prototypes to illustrate new ideas or approaches
  • Being data-driven and always seeking new ways of improving your services

Preferred Qualifications

  • 9 or more years of relevant work experience with a Bachelor Degree or 7 or more relevant years of experience with an Advanced Degree (e.g. Masters, MBA, JD, MD) or 3 or more years of experience with a PhD
  • Hands-on experience in at least one of the back-end programming languages like JAVA, Python, PHP or NodeJS
  • Highly prefer deep technical knowledge around successfully architecting and building complex software systems at scale with high availability, low latency & strong data consistency
  • Experience working with different kinds of technology (e.g. JavaScript, Java, Python) in one platform and streamlining them for the best possible product solution
  • Experience leading a high performing engineering team with 3 years of people management experience
  • Highly prefer hands-on experience building high performing Open Banking solutions for the North American market

Benefits

  • Medical
  • Dental
  • Vision
  • 401(k)
  • FSA/HSA
  • Life Insurance
  • Paid Time Off
  • Wellness Program
  • Bonus
  • Equity
  • Remote work

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.